At a Glance
- Tasks: Design and implement automated tests for complex systems and improve testing practices.
- Company: Join a cutting-edge Software Lab in Belfast with a collaborative team.
- Benefits: Competitive salary, bonus, flexible remote work, and opportunities for professional growth.
- Why this job: Make a real impact by ensuring software quality across innovative digital and physical systems.
- Qualifications: Strong test automation experience and familiarity with CI/CD pipelines.
- Other info: Dynamic environment with excellent career advancement opportunities.
The predicted salary is between 60000 - 70000 £ per year.
We’re looking for a hands-on Senior Test Automation Engineer to help build and scale automated testing across complex, real-world systems. This role goes beyond component-level testing. You’ll focus on integration and system-level quality, ensuring software works seamlessly across services, platforms, and environments.
You’ll join a growing state of the art Software Lab in a small team set up building the bridge between physical machinery with digital systems and platforms.
Working in a tight knit team you’ll carry out the following tasks:
- Design and implement automated test coverage across API, integration, and system layers
- Build and maintain scalable test frameworks (UI, API, end-to-end)
- Integrate automated testing into CI/CD pipelines for continuous validation
- Define test strategies, coverage, and quality metrics for releases
- Investigate failures, debug issues, and support teams in resolving defects
- Work closely with engineering teams to improve testability and reliability
- Contribute to release confidence through robust regression and system testing
- Continuously improve automation, tooling, and testing practices
What we’re seeking:
- Strong experience in test automation (e.g. Selenium, Playwright, Robot Framework or similar)
- Experience testing integrated systems (APIs, services, end-to-end workflows)
- Hands-on with CI/CD pipelines and version control (Git)
- Solid understanding of testing principles and quality engineering
- Comfortable debugging issues across logs, services, and environments
- A proactive mindset - someone who naturally looks to automate and improve
Nice to have (not essential):
- Experience in complex or distributed systems (e.g. IoT, embedded, industrial, or data platforms)
- Exposure to API technologies (REST, GraphQL, messaging systems)
- Familiarity with Linux environments
- Understanding of security or regulated environments
Sounding good? Apply via the link below or contact Stephen at
Senior Test Automation Engineer in Newtownabbey employer: Kura
Contact Detail:
Kura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Test Automation Engineer in Newtownabbey
✨Tip Number 1
Network like a pro! Reach out to folks in the industry, attend meetups, and connect with potential colleagues on LinkedIn. You never know who might have the inside scoop on job openings or can put in a good word for you.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your test automation projects, especially those involving complex systems. This will give you an edge and demonstrate your hands-on experience to potential employers.
✨Tip Number 3
Prepare for interviews by brushing up on common test automation scenarios and challenges. Practice explaining your thought process and how you've tackled issues in past projects. Confidence is key!
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en. Plus, it shows you’re genuinely interested in joining our team at StudySmarter.
We think you need these skills to ace Senior Test Automation Engineer in Newtownabbey
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ience in test automation and integration testing. We want to see how your skills align with the role, so don’t be shy about showcasing relevant projects or technologies you've worked with!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you’re passionate about test automation and how you can contribute to our team. We love seeing enthusiasm and a proactive mindset, so let that personality come through!
Showcase Your Technical Skills: When filling out your application, make sure to mention specific tools and frameworks you’ve used, like Selenium or Playwright. We’re looking for hands-on experience, so give us the details on how you’ve applied these in real-world scenarios.
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way to ensure your application gets into the right hands. Plus, it shows us you’re serious about joining our awesome team at StudySmarter!
How to prepare for a job interview at Kura
✨Know Your Tools Inside Out
Make sure you’re well-versed in the test automation tools mentioned in the job description, like Selenium or Playwright. Be ready to discuss your hands-on experience with these tools and how you've used them to build scalable test frameworks.
✨Showcase Your Problem-Solving Skills
Prepare examples of how you've debugged issues and resolved defects in previous roles. Highlight specific instances where your proactive mindset led to improvements in automation or testing practices.
✨Understand CI/CD Pipelines
Since this role involves integrating automated testing into CI/CD pipelines, brush up on your knowledge of version control systems like Git. Be prepared to explain how you’ve implemented continuous validation in past projects.
✨Familiarise Yourself with the Company’s Tech Stack
Research the company’s products and technologies, especially if they involve complex or distributed systems. Showing that you understand their environment will demonstrate your genuine interest and help you stand out.